Special Temporary Authority application - Initial values - Purpose of Operation
Please explain the purpose of operation:
This communication system’s purpose is to increase the amount of spectrum available to DoD operations. The tests will be a combination of short (minutes) and long term (several hours) duration tests during the 6 month STA period. The system uses Dynamic Spectrum Access (DSA) software that enables operation on unused channels without causing interference to legacy systems. The system uses spectrum sensing to determine channels not used by legacy transceivers. The system automatically chooses an acceptable channel based on the potential interference to legacy users and interference from other users.
